Realizing that families and long-distance drivers like saving money and the environment at the same time, the designers at Toyota have come up with a larger version of the Toyota Prius for 2012: the Prius V. While both hybrid Prius models have 4 doors, seat 5 passengers and have a hatchback, the Prius V wagon is more powerful and has much more legroom and a longer wheelbase than its smaller sibling.
The 2012 Toyota Prius V is available in three front-wheel-drive trim levels: Two, Three and Five. Each have a direct-injected, 1.8-liter, 16-valve, VVT-I DOHC 4-cylinder aluminum engine with an electronically controlled continuously variable automatic transmission. The Prius V’s hybrid powertrain reaches a max horsepower of 134 and max torque of 153 pound feet (105 of which emanate from the gas engine). The electric engine generates 80 hp on its own. All trim levels of the Prius V, which is considered a super ultra low emission vehicle, are estimated by the EPA to achieve 44 mpg city/40 highway.
The wheelbase of the 2012 Toyota Prius V is 9 inches longer than the standard Prius's, and the car is also more than 5 inches taller. Where the bigger version really shines is in cargo space, which, at 34.3 cubic feet, is more than twice the cargo space of the 2012 Toyota Prius C. The Prius V also rides on larger wheels—16- or 17-inchers as opposed to 15-inchers—giving it slightly more ground clearance as well.
Standard features available for all 2012 Toyota Prius V trims include projector-beam halogen headlights, LED taillights, heated power folding exterior mirrors, intermittent front and rear wipers, a rear defogger, rear spoiler, automatic climate control, remote keyless entry, smart-key system with push-button start, cloth seating surfaces, 6-way adjustable driver’s seat with power lumbar support, 4-way adjustable front passenger seat, tilt-and-telescopic steering wheel with mounted audio, climate and Bluetooth Hands-free controls, cruise control, a 6-speaker audio system with AM/FM/CD player with MP3/WMA playback capability, a 6.1-inch touchscreen display with integrated backup camera and 16-inch, 10-spoke aluminum alloy wheels with wheel covers and all-season tires.
Upgrading to the Prius V Three trim adds a navigation system and tilt-telescopic steering wheel with additional voice command controls. For buyers choosing the Prius V Five trim, the standard equipment includes integrated foglights, SofTex-trimmed seating surfaces, heated front seats, an auto-dimming rear-view mirror, and 17-inch 10-spoke aluminum alloy wheels with all-season tires. Items that are available with certain packages include a panoramic moonroof, 8-speaker JBL premium sound system with AM/FM/CD player with MP3/WMA playback capability, amplifier and 7-inch touchscreen display, an advanced parking guidance system and dynamic radar cruise control.
The 2012 Prius V comes standard with Toyota’s Star Safety System, which includes vehicle stability control, traction control and 4-wheel antilock brakes with electronic brakeforce distribution, brake assist and smart-stop technology. Other safety features that are standard for all Prius V trims include 7 airbags—driver and front passenger seat-mounted side airbags, front- and rear-side curtain airbags and a driver’s knee airbag—as well as an energy-absorbing steering column, side-impact door beams, tire pressure monitoring system, hill start assist control and a vehicle proximity notification system.
Current owners of the 2012 Prius V, which made its debut in the fall of 2011, mostly rave about its gas mileage, especially in this era of high gas prices. Many state they have been able to achieve close to 50 mpg on the highway, exceeding the EPA’s rating for the vehicle. Others note how quiet the ride is and how easy it is to switch from gas to Eco mode. The extra cargo space also receives rave reviews as well.
Although very similar in size and shape to the Prius C, the 2012 Toyota Prius V will appeal to drivers who use their vehicle to travel long distances or need the extra cargo space the Prius V affords. Priced competitively when compared to other hybrids in the market, such as the Ford Escape and Honda Accord, the extra size makes the Prius V almost like a crossover SUV that gets incredible gas mileage.

(14 reviews)I went from a 2006 Prius to the 2012 Prius V. The ride in the V is smoother, quieter, vehicle feels heavier, more grounded. Cargo space is larger. The back seats move forward and back separately and also recline. Even though the back side windows are more streamlined, the mirrors accommodate and the visibility is good. The 2012 V with opt pkg 2 had the features most important to me: b/u camera, Bluetooth, cloth seats and smart key. The smart key feature was confusing when shopping. Key-less entry is not the same as smart key, although they are often used interchangeably in vehicle descriptions. Smart key has a chip in the door handle which allows the doors to be locked/unlocked without having the key in hand. On my opt pkg 2 only the drivers door has this chip, while my old Prius had chips in the 2 front doors and in the back hatch handle. A slight inconvenience but not a deal-breaker. One of the first things I did was change the door lock setting so that all doors unlock simultaneously. I imagine the default is to have only the drivers door unlock for safety reasons, but it is a source of frustration for me. I am very happy with my purchase, love my Prius V. Although the Prius V is technically a "station wagon" it certainly does not look like one. It comes off looking more like a smaller SUV or a Crossover. The design is so sleek and suburban that you really don't need to have a family to own this car. I'm a 26-year old and I use this car to pack friends in for a night out and to haul groceries back home. The cargo space is definitely bigger than some of my families' smaller SUVs. The drive is smooth and quiet. Gas mileage is fantastic - I get anywhere from 44 mpg to 56 mpg on the highway. I definitely feel in control when I drive in the city or on the highway.
